syndicate
('s/I/nd/I/k/@/t )

noun (n)

  • a loose affiliation of gangsters in charge of organized criminal activities(noun.group)
    source: wordnet30
  • an association of companies for some definite purpose(noun.group)
    Synonym:
    consortium, pool
    source: wordnet30
  • a news agency that sells features or articles or photographs etc. to newspapers for simultaneous publication(noun.group)
    source: wordnet30
  • The office or jurisdiction of a syndic; a council, or body of syndics.(noun)
    source: webster1913

verb (v)

  • join together into a syndicate(verb.social)
    Example:
    The banks syndicated.
    source: wordnet30
  • organize into or form a syndicate(verb.social)
    source: wordnet30
  • sell articles, television programs, or photos to several publications or independent broadcasting stations(verb.possession)
    source: wordnet30
  • To judge; to censure.(verb)
    source: webster1913
  • To combine or form into, or manage as, a syndicate.(verb)
    source: webster1913
  • To unite to form a syndicate.(verb)
